En la gestión diaria de archivos, a menudo nos encontramos con situaciones en las que el nombre del archivo contiene sufijos adicionales o marcas temporales, como marcas de fecha, números de versión o etiquetas de clasificación temporales generadas automáticamente. Estos textos, que generalmente se encuentran al final del nombre del archivo en el extremo derecho, no solo afectan la limpieza general del nombre del archivo, sino que también pueden obstaculizar la recuperación y organización del archivo. Cuando hay cientos de archivos que necesitamos eliminar y renombrar, modificarlos manualmente uno por uno. Es una pérdida de tiempo y existe el riesgo de errores. Aquí hay tres métodos para eliminar el nombre del archivo en el extremo derecho del texto en lotes. De acuerdo con las ventajas y desventajas, ayúdelo a analizar en detalle y elegir la opción que más le convenga. ¡Aprémoslo conmigo!
¿En qué circunstancias necesito eliminar el contenido de texto en el extremo derecho del nombre del archivo?
- Al organizar archivos en lotes, eliminando el contenido de texto en el extremo derecho del nombre del archivo, puede eliminar el número de versión o la fecha redundantes, de modo que el nombre del archivo esté limpio y unificado. ,
- Cuando hay sufijos como marcas de tiempo redundantes o información de marcado en el nombre del archivo, eliminar el texto al final puede eliminar esta información redundante, retener contenido importante y facilitar la identificación y búsqueda rápidas.
- Cuando el archivo necesita ser procesado en el sistema o en una herramienta de software, eliminar el contenido redundante al final del extremo derecho puede evitar que el nombre del archivo sea demasiado largo y el formato no coincida.
Vista previa del efecto de eliminar por lotes la marca de fecha en el extremo derecho del nombre de archivo
Antes de procesar:
Después del procesamiento:
Método 1: usar HeSoft Doc Batch Tool Eliminar por lotes el sufijo del nombre del archivo
Índice recomendado:★★★★★
Ventajas:
- Admite la eliminación por lotes de una gran cantidad de archivos, evite ir manualmente uno por uno.
- Todos los archivos se procesan localmente y no implican la naturaleza de carga, lo que protege la privacidad del usuario.
Desventajas:
- Es necesario instalar el software para operar en la computadora.
Pasos de operación:
1. Abrir 【 HeSoft Doc Batch Tool 】, Seleccione [Nombre del archivo]-[Eliminar texto en el nombre del archivo].
2. Seleccione un método en [Agregar archivo] o [Importar archivo de carpeta] para agregar un archivo que necesite eliminar el texto en el extremo derecho del nombre del archivo, o arrastre el archivo directamente a la parte inferior para confirmar que no hay ningún problema con el archivo importado, haga clic Siguiente.
3. Ingrese a la interfaz de configuración de opciones, seleccione [Varios textos en el extremo derecho] en el tipo de operación, y luego seleccione el número de caracteres que deben eliminarse (caracteres calculados de derecha a izquierda) en el número a continuación. Después de seleccionar, haga clic en Siguiente nuevamente. Luego haga clic en Examinar y seleccione la ubicación donde se guardará el nuevo archivo después de cambiar el nombre.
4. Una vez finalizado el procesamiento, haga clic en la ruta roja de la ruta de guardado para abrir la carpeta y ver los archivos procesados.
Método 2: use el procesamiento por lotes de archivos bat de Windows para eliminar la cantidad especificada de texto en el lado derecho del nombre de archivo
Índice recomendado:★★★☆☆
Ventajas:
- La velocidad de procesamiento es más rápida y puede procesar archivos en grandes cantidades.
- Soporte nativo de Windows, sin necesidad de instalar software adicional.
Desventajas:
- No se pueden procesar archivos en subcarpetas al mismo tiempo.
- No se puede reconocer solo el separador y no se puede restaurar después de la modificación.
Pasos de operación:
1. Cree un nuevo archivo de texto TXT en la carpeta que contiene el archivo de sufijo que necesita eliminar y cambie el nombre a remove_right_text.bat.
2. Haga clic con el botón derecho para editar e ingrese el código a continuación.
@ Echo off Setlocal enabledelayedexpansion For % % f in (*) do ( Conjunto "filename = % % ~ Nf" Set "newname =! Filename: ~ 0,-10! " Ren "% % f" "! ¡Newname! % % ~ Xf" )3. Después de guardar, haga doble clic para ejecutar el archivo.
Método 3: Utilice el comando PowerShell para eliminar uniformemente parte del texto del nombre del archivo
Índice recomendado:★★★☆☆
Ventajas:
- Admite reglas de coincidencia complejas para expresiones regulares para eliminar texto.
- Soporte oficial de Windows, seguro y sin riesgos.
Desventajas:
- Necesita aprender el conocimiento básico de la línea de comandos.
- Si no hay un separador entre los nombres de archivo, existe el riesgo de error.
Pasos de operación:
1. Mantenga presionada la tecla Mayús y haga clic con el botón derecho en la carpeta que contiene el archivo que necesita ser renombrado y seleccione [Abrir la ventana de PowerShell aquí].
2. Ingrese el comando a continuación.
Get-ChildItem | Rename-Item -NewName {
$ Base = $ _.BaseName
$ New = $ base.Substring(0, $ base.LastIndexOf('))
$ Nuevo + $ _.Extension
}
3. Luego ejecute el comando.